In many communities, nonprofit organizations exist to meet unmet needs, delivering essential services to individuals, families, and neighborhoods. In this certificate, you will learn how to build long-term strategy for growth and sustainability. In addition, you will also learn how to effectively implement the three R’s of volunteer management: Recruit, Retain, and Reward and specific strategies to lead nonprofit organizational employees and volunteers.
